Made an early morning run to St. Mark's with my daughter and a buddy of mine. Beautiful day. Launched around 0845, first bait in the water by 0930. Ran East and fished deeper water most of the day (5'-7'), but did get in shallow a could times. Threw everthing in the box (live shrimp, live pinfish, plastics, lures, GULPs, etc.) Didn't catch much, but did have a good mix (trout, spanish, blue, flounder, ladyfish, catfish). All but one of the trout were short. Had a live pinfish floating behind the boat under a CT on a Penn Live Liner. Something grabbed the bait and was off and running; live liner was smoking. Never saw it; bit off. Headed West for a peak and managed a couple more short trout. Boat on the trailer around 1600, grabbed some lunch, then made the trip back to Albany.
Brought home:
2- Spanish
1- trout (around 17")
1- good size blue (20+)
1- flounder
